Post subject:  rudder adjustment

i had to replace the tiller cross bar.the original one corroded and the end broke off.i have the old style non-adjustable rudders.the spare cross bar i have is the new style that adjusts at the ends.i set it so it is the same length as the old one which was pretty easy!the rudders look straight.i was wondering if there is a measurement used to make sure they are straight and do not create excess drag.kind of like setting the toe on a vehicle.can i measure the distance between the rudders to set them straight!?what is that measurement?thanks!

Author:  HRob [ Mon Jun 11, 2012 9:02 pm ]
Post subject:  Re: rudder adjustment

That's exactly right, about a 1/4" toe-in.

viewtopic.php?f=18&t=467

Author:  MBounds [ Tue Jun 12, 2012 4:45 am ]
Post subject:  Re: rudder adjustment

On a 16, the measurement is 1/8" to 1/4".
